Introduction

The objective of this study should be to review an article titled A group of One: Behaviorally Targeted Advertisements as Implied Social Labeling (Summers, et al. 2016 p 156). The creators argue that companies have counted on targeting to communicate effectively having a group of customers. Targeting is definitely the segmentation that involves selection coming from a smaller group based on described variables. One common type of segmentation variables that firms use includes demographic variables using the gender and ethnicity as well as psychographic variables that include life-style, personality and values. Yet , an advanced in technology, and widespread in the internet has made a new form of targeting rising. A behavioral targeting is referred while an web-based marketing strategy employing different components that include surfing around history and client purchase to support in deciding the type of advertising campaigns design and display. Commonly, consumers are presented the digital adverts to reflect the marketing preferences based on their previous actions. For example , the algorithms might be developed to spot consumer who likes to make an online purchasing of energy-saving bulbs. Due to the fact that this practice frequently occurs in the online marketing environment, the authors check out the difference among method buyer response to traditional types of targeting, and behaviorally targeted advertisements.

Literature Review

Tucker, (2014) argues that the internet has revolutionized the way marketers employ in designing their campaign. With the strategy used in collecting customer data using the website system, the advertisers are able to design and style the advertising campaigns that will be focused on consumers choices. For example , the internet clicks may be used to collect the info about the specific products that consumers like. Unlike the traditional method of ad that does not have a similar advantages, in this scenario, businesses are able to possess huge amounts of data at their disposal to enhance advertising results, but whom also seek to minimize the potential for consumer level of resistance. (Tucker, 2014 p 1). The data accumulated from consumers will assist marketer to design the web adverts more desirable. Despite the rewards that can be derived from online advertising campaigns, the marketers still deal with the risks of intruding in the privacy of shoppers. At shows, increasing range of sophisticated individuals are wary of submitting their personal information on the net. The author shows that advertisers must make consumers understand that all their information is secure and will not really be abused.

Yan, ainsi que al. (2009) contribute to the argument by pointing out that marketers take advantages of behavioral concentrating on to collect significant volume of consumer information. Using the strategy, the advertisers can easily top style the ads that will meet consumers personal preferences. Yan, ou al. (2009) identify the CTR(Click-Through Rate) as a technique that promoters employ to collect consumer info, which helps them to correctly segmenting users for behaviorally targeted advertising in a sponsored search. (Yan, et ing. 2009 p 261). Therefore, the creators establish that behavioral concentrating on assists advertisers in building effective internet advertising. Moreover, the authors disclose behavioral focusing on help marketers to use evaluation metrics to investigate the effectiveness of their adverts. Moreover, the behavioral targeting works more effectively than others form of on the net or classic ads delivery.

Assumptive development

The writers develop distinct theoretical frames related to behavioral advertising simply by arguing that behavioral segmented adverts are different from the traditional advertising campaign based on the psychographic and demographic parameters. The behavioral ads use the Web page to customize a great appeal for every single user who have visits this website. However , the advert method is different from the standard mode of adverts offered to everyone no matter all their demographic factors. Moreover, the behaviorally targeted ads are created differently from another type of advertisements because companies are able to collect information about customers since customer data will be stored in hard drives (cookies). For example , firms are able to gather information about clients clicking patterns, purchase chronicles, and internet searches. Elevating number of firms are also using the software to spot peoples psychographic traits just like personality, principles, and cultural identities.

Additionally , firms make use of the social labels to develop client explicit characterizations based on their particular personality, values and habit. Based on self-perception theory that reveals how people illustrate certain behaviours based on their particular traits, the authors argue that implied sociable label may be used to develop the buyer identity to develop behavioral consumer adverts.
